The successful candidate will become part of the Research Group of Metamaterials. Focus areas of the group are design, fabrication and characterization of novel nanostructures for application in nanophotonics. Our interest is mainly in so-called metamaterials, with artificially engineered optical and electromagnetic properties, e.g. hyperbolic metamaterials, epsilon-near-zero materials, water-based metamaterials, all-dielectric metasurfaces for a wide variety of waves from visible to microwave frequencies. We are massively using DTU Nanolab (cleanroom) facilities for advanced nanofabrication.

The successful candidate is expected to contribute forefront research and innovation within nanophotonics. A special focus will be given for the mid-infrared wavelength region for spectroscopic and sensing purposes. Detection and identification of molecules has a significant impact on both fundamental research and various applications from environmental monitoring to medical and clinical diagnosis. The mid-infrared absorption spectroscopy offers a unique label-free detection scheme thanks to the characteristic light absorption features of molecules in the mid-infrared wavelengths.  The position is to generate fundamental insight relevant to novel nano-optic phenomena in nanostructures and to apply them for mid-infrared absorption sensing to improve the sensitivity of biomarkers detection.
